Commercial Slab Installation in Littleton, CO
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ete foundations for a variety of property projects, including warehouses, retail stores, parking lots, and industrial facilities. This process ensures a stable and durable base for structures, driveways, or outdoor spaces, often requiring precise planning and site preparation to meet the specific needs of each project. Property owners typically seek these services when constructing new commercial buildings or upgrading existing facilities, and they usually want to understand the scope of work, material quality, and the importance of proper site preparation to ensure long-lasting results.
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ners should consider factors such as the size and design of the slab, the load requirements, and any existing site conditions that could impact the work. It’s also helpful to understand the timeline for completion and any necessary permits or approvals. Clear communication about project expectations and site specifics can help ensure the installation process proceeds smoothly and results in a foundation that supports the property's intended use effectively.

Commercial Slab Installation Questions
What types of projects require commercial slab installation? Commercial slab installation is often needed for building foundations, loading docks, parking areas, and outdoor workspaces on commercial properties.
What materials are commonly used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the most common material, chosen for its durability and strength, with options like reinforced or stamped concrete for specific applications.
How does site preparation impact slab installation? Proper site preparation ensures a stable base, reduces the risk of cracking, and extends the lifespan of the slab.
What should property owners consider before installing a commercial slab? Factors include the intended use, load requirements, soil conditions, and local building codes to ensure proper design and durability.
